The Island Union of the General Union of Workers (UGT) in Lanzarote makes an urgent call to the working class and the society of Lanzarote to mobilize in solidarity with the Palestinian people in the face of the serious humanitarian situation and the genocide being perpetrated in the Gaza Strip.

The gathering will be this Wednesday, October 15, from 11:00 AM to 12:00 PM in front of the Arrecife City Hall.

The objective of this action is to "make this injustice visible" and "for reflection and to not forget what has been done against the people of Gaza."

According to them, this gathering is convened due to "the pressing need to show the sensitivity, empathy, and condemnation of the workers in the face of the atrocity being committed in Gaza, where dramatic death tolls have been reported, including those caused by direct attacks and by famine."

Even if there has been a ceasefire agreement or hostage release, "we know that the State of Israel will not stop in its genocidal, expansionist, and supremacist plans. There have already been other truces that Israel has always boycotted to continue its policy of colonization and ethnic cleansing in Gaza and the West Bank, attacking and besieging the Palestinian population, protected by the impunity granted by the US."

In this sense, "and consistent with our principles, we want to take the message of condemnation and solidarity to the streets of the island, so UGT Lanzarote calls for a public gathering in the capital."

From UGT they recall that, as a union, "it is not only our responsibility to be exclusively in the labor field, but also as part of our society and our solidarity." Therefore, "it is a scandal and an atrocity to look the other way" in the face of the situation.

UGT Lanzarote reiterates its call for "solidarity, to mobilize and demand an immediate cessation of violence and a firm stance for the international recognition of the State of Palestine."
